  2. If possible, I would upgrade WordPress. The jQuery is most likely incompatible between the latest Gravity Forms and the version of WordPress you're using. We always recommend using the latest version of WordPress, and Gravity Forms requires WordPress version 3.0 minimum (noted in the footer of each page.)
